First off all this computer has WinXP-SP3 and Microsoft Office 12 Enterprise
edition.

I am having this strange issue.
Outlook 2007 (SP2) crashes with the following error:
"The necessary file MAPI32.dll wasn´t found in the path. Please re-install
Microsoft Office Outlook." (This a translation from the original error wich
is in portuguese).

In event viwer I get this:
"Faulting application outlook.exe, version 12.0.6423.1000, stamp 49b08185,
faulting module kernel32.dll, version 5.1.2600.5781, stamp 49c4f4ba, debug?
0, fault address 0x00012afb".

I run scanpst.exe both in the outlook.ost file and the archive file (*.pst)
which found and corrected several errors. But when I (re)start outlook it
starts to update the folders but after (more or less) 2 minutes crashes and
asks for restart, showing the errors previously discribed.
I have already unistalled Office 2007, renamed the outlook folder that
exists in the "%userprofile%\local settings\application
data\Microsoft\outlook", re-istalled office 2007 but the error keeps comming
back!

What can I do? Is there a way off re-installing MAPI32.dll? Is it enough to
copy the missing dll from another computer and run REGSVR32.exe?
